Retirement Planning Careers Offer New Job Opportunities
As baby boomers begin to reach retirement age many are not thinking about swapping the office desk for a rocking chair and are looking for a change of pace once they hit retirement age. Many are being welcomed into retirement planning careers to put the skills they learned throughout their working life to use to benefit younger workers. With more companies offering 401K retirement plans in addition to other retirement benefits many workers are lost when it comes to how best insure they have enough money to live on after retirement. You do not have to be a financial wiz or even have experience as a financial advisor to have a career in financial planning. Companies are looking for people with valuable skills in accounting, communication and other fields. These skills can't be built upon and with a bit of training a person can become very skilled creating financial plans for individuals and companies. Those looking for retirement planning careers can help many companies put together retirement plans for their employees including the funding options and disbursement of many of the plans.
There are different aspects of financial planning that might be appealing. There are some who work to market and sale the services of financial planning consultants. There are others who work directly with companies in setting up a plan that is a good fit for the employees of that company. Others offer support to companies who have a retirement plan in place.
Learning New Trends In Financial Services
In addition to setting up and maintaining plans, financial consultant services handle the disbursing of retirement funds and possible loans that may be option under certain retirement plans. The financial world is ever changing and that includes types of retirement investment plans. A financial consultant will keep the company informed as changes and new plans become available and help companies decide how they should respond to these changes.
The skills that a person has obtained through working for many years can be put to good use by retirement planning companies. In every aspect of the services they provide they benefit from the knowledge of those who have experience in different areas. For this reason there continue to be more opportunities made available for people getting close to retirement who would like to start a new career in financial planning. For those not ready to walk away from the job or those already retired and seeking a means of staying in touch with the business world can find retirement planning careers rewarding and a new challenge from previous jobs. Building a new career is common for those reaching retirement age but not yet ready to sit on the porch all day.
